Overview

Physician Assistant | Nurse Practitioner, Urology Specialists of East Tennessee Fort Sanders Regional

Full time, 80 hours per pay period, Day shift

Travel Required between two offices- Knoxville and Alcoa.

Covenant Medical Group is Covenant Health’s employed and managed medical practice organization, with more than 300 top Physicians and providers spanning the continuum of care in 20 cities throughout East Tennessee. Specialties include cardiology, cardiothoracic surgery, cardiovascular surgery, endocrinology, gastroenterology, general surgery, infectious disease, neurology, neurosurgery, obstetrics and gynecology, occupational medicine, orthopedic surgery, physical medicine and rehabilitation, primary care, pulmonology, reproductive medicine, rheumatology, sleep medicine and urology.

Position Summary:

The Physician Assistant augments a physician's ability to provide patient care services by independently and interdependently scheduling, supervising, and/or conducting complex diagnostic and therapeutic procedures; independently participates in the delivery of direct patient care within the scope of individual authority granted by the Tennessee Board. May supervise support staff.

Responsibilities

Obtains detailed history and performs physical examinations on assigned patients; assesses and treats acute/chronic medical problems and provides direct patient care to a specified patient population.

Delivers patient care within the scope of approved privileges

Obtains complete and accurate patient information in order to determine appropriate treatment plan

Orders and/or administers appropriate medical tests

Performs treatments quickly and efficiently while keeping patient informed

Delivers care in a manner to ensure the patient's comfort during treatment

Communicates effectively with patient and healthcare team

Addresses health care issues appropriately according to established protocols

Consistently and continually monitors the quality of care delivered

Develops and implements outcome based, individualized and appropriate plans for patient care.

Plans, manages and coordinates patient care

Provides patient and family education and counseling either directly or by referral

Intervenes and diffuses situations involving agitated and confused or emotional patients and/or family members

Consults and coordinates with health care providers; works as a member of the team

Provides assistance to the health care providers by answering questions or otherwise providing information regarding patient care

Works in coordination with the health care providers and other team members to develop and appropriately implement treatment plans for patients

Works with other members of the team to ensure a timely flow of patients

Works in coordination with management to provide quality delivery of care

Participates in fulfilling the mission, vision, goals and objectives of the organization

Maintains a safe and clean work environment; reports defective or missing equipment and safety hazards

Assists in disaster planning and related activities

Completes chart reviews on a regular basis

Ensure the Joint Commission and other regulatory standards are met as they apply to the department

Abides by policies, procedures and bylaws

Assist in various committee/meeting responsibilities for the department

Communicates effectively

Listens to patients concerns and addresses issues as appropriate

Ensures that verbal and written orders are clear, concise, and ensures instructions are understood by listening and requesting feedback

Writes patient notes legibly and clearly in order to provide adequate information for other health care providers

Listens for clues that patient needs additional assistance in understanding the treatment plan or in carrying out treatment plan

Adjusts communication style depending on receiver of the message, for example, education level, etc.

Collaborate with the patient, physician and other care team members as part of a team based approach to overall patient care.

Perform other duties as assigned or requested.

Qualifications

Minimum Education:

None specified; however, must be sufficient to meet the standards for achievement of the below indicated license and/or certification as required by the issuing authority.

Minimum Experience:

Previous experience as Physician Assistant. Ability to perform comprehensive medical histories and physicals which includes dictation skills. Ability to evaluate and initiate treatment of acute and chronic medical problems. Ability to communicate complex medical information to a diverse population.Hospital and surgery assistance experience preferred.

Licensure Requirement:

Licensed as a physician assistant by the Tennessee Board of Medical Examiners. CPR required.
